山柰根茎石油醚萃取部位的化学成分研究

采用硅胶、Sephadex LH-20和ODS、MCI柱色谱法及半制备型高效液相色谱对山柰根茎的75%乙醇提取物进行分离纯化,并对分离得到的化合物进行鉴定.从提取物的石油醚萃取部位分离得到22个化合物,分别鉴定为(-)-clovane-2,9-diol(1),(-)-4α,7α-aromadendranediol(2),caryolane-1,9β-diol(3),15-hydroxy-a-cadinol(4),cryptomeridiol(5),oxyphyllenodiol B(6),(4S,7S)-4-hydroxy-1,10-seco-muurol-5-ene-1,10-dione(7),junipediol(8),guaianediol(9),(-)-(4S,6S)-6-hydroxypiperitone(10),(4S,5R)-5-hydroxypiperitone(11),(4S,5S)-5-hydroxypiperitone(12),(R)-8-hydroxycarvo-tanacetone(13),(-)-(1R,4S,6S)-1,6-dihydroxy-2-menthene(14),4-methyl-3-(3-oxo-l-butyl)-2-penten-4-olide(15),5-羟甲基-2-呋喃甲醛(16),反式-对甲氧基肉桂酸乙酯(17),反式-4-甲氧基肉桂酸(18),对羟基苯甲酸(19),茴香酸(20),2,3-二羟基-3-(4-甲氧基苯基)丙酸甲酯(21),2,3-二羟基-3-(4-甲氧基苯基)丙酸乙酯(22).其中,化合物1~9为倍半萜,化合物10~14为对薄荷烷型单萜;化合物1~16为首次从该植物中分离得到.
Chemical Constituents of Petroleum Ether Extract from the Rhizome of Kaempferia galanga L.
Twenty-two compounds were isolated and purified from the petroleum ether extract of the 75%ethanol extract ob-tained from the rhizome of Aromatic ginger(Kaempferia galanga L.).This purification process involved chromatography on silica gel,Sephadex LH-20,ODS,MCI,and RP-HPLC.Based on a thorough examination of physicochemical properties and spectral analyses,the chemical structures of the isolated compounds were identified as(-)-clovane-2,9-diol(1),(-)-4α,7α-aromaden-dranediol(2),caryolane-1,9β-diol(3),15-hydroxy-α-cadinol(4),cryptomeridiol(5),oxyphyllenodiol B(6),(4S,7S)-4-hydroxy-1,10-seco-muurol-5-ene-1,10-dione(7),junipediol(8),guaianediol(9),(-)-(4S,6S)-6-hydroxypiperitone(10),(4S,5R)-5-hydroxypiperitone(11),(4S,5S)-5-hydroxypiperitone(12),(R)-8-hydroxycarvotanacetone(13),(-)-(1R,4S,6S)-1,6-dihydroxy-2-menthene(14),4-methyl-3-(3-oxo-l-butyl)-2-penten-4-olide(15),5-hydroxymethyl-2-furancarboxaldehyde(16),ethyl-trans-p-methoxycinnamat(17),trans-4-methoxycinnamic acid(18),p-hydroxybenzoic acid(19),anise acid(20),methyl-2,3-dihydroxy-3-(4-methoxyphenyl)propanoate(21),ethyl-2,3-dihydroxy-3-(4-methoxyphenyl)propanoate(22).Compounds 1-9 belong to sesquiterpenes,while compounds 10-14 are p-menthane monoterpenes.Notably,compounds 1-16 were isolated from this plant for the first time.
